Requisite

Definition:

(noun) Something that is required or necessary.

(adjective) Made necessary by particular circumstances or regulations.

Examples:

(noun)

  1. Education is a requisite for success in life.
  2. I have obtained all the requisites for the job.

(adjective)

  1. A valid passport is requisite for international travel.
  2. The employee failed to meet the requisite qualifications.
